Starting March 3rd, the Laurier Grappling Club will offer women's* only sessions in addition to their regular sessions which are open to everyone.
The women's only sessions will run weekly on Sundays from 3:00-4:00pm. These sessions are primarily focused on practicing and sharing wrestling and Brazilian jiu-jitsu techniques.
The regular sessions run weekly on Tuesdays and Thursdays from 8:30-9:30am and on Saturdays from 2:00-4:00pm. All sessions take place at Precision Mixed Martial Arts in Kitchener. Â
Female participants can register for $80, which provides access to both the women's only session and the regular sessions each week for the remainder of the winter term.Â
While participants of all skill levels are welcome, the club's current focus is geared towards creating a supportive environment where beginners can learn, train, and grow.
